What Should Six Foot Tall Individuals Look for in a Weight Bench?
When selecting the best weight benches for six-foot tall individuals, there are several key features to consider for optimal comfort and effectiveness.
- Adjustable Height: Look for benches that allow for height adjustments to accommodate longer legs and provide better alignment during exercises.
- Bench Length: A longer bench length is crucial for taller individuals to ensure that their back and head are fully supported during bench presses and other exercises.
- Weight Capacity: Ensure the bench has a high weight capacity to accommodate the additional weight that may come with taller individuals who are often more muscular.
- Backrest Angle Adjustability: An adjustable backrest can enhance versatility, enabling different angles for various exercises while maintaining comfort for taller frames.
- Stability and Durability: Opt for benches made from high-quality materials that provide stability, as taller individuals may require more stability during heavier lifts.
Adjustable height benches can provide a more customized fit for six-foot tall individuals, allowing them to achieve proper posture and alignment, which is essential for effective workouts and injury prevention.
A longer bench length is necessary to accommodate taller users, ensuring their entire body is properly supported. This prevents strain and enhances safety during exercises like bench presses, where stability is paramount.
The weight capacity of a bench should be sufficient to support heavier weights, which is often needed by taller individuals who may have larger muscle mass. This ensures the bench remains safe and stable during workouts.
An adjustable backrest angle allows for various exercises, such as incline or decline presses, catering to the workout preferences of taller users. This flexibility helps target different muscle groups effectively while maintaining comfort.
Finally, stability and durability are critical considerations, as a robust bench will withstand the rigors of heavy lifting. Taller individuals often generate more force during lifts, so a stable and well-constructed bench is essential for safety and performance.
Which Types of Weight Benches Are Best for Taller Users?
The best weight benches for six-foot-tall users should provide ample support, adjustability, and comfort during workouts.
- Adjustable Benches: These benches can be adjusted to various angles, allowing taller users to find a comfortable position for exercises like bench presses and dumbbell lifts. They often feature a higher backrest, which provides better support for the upper body, ensuring that the user’s head and neck are adequately supported while lifting.
- Flat Benches: A sturdy flat bench is ideal for taller users looking for stability during their workouts. These benches are typically lower to the ground, making them suitable for a range of exercises, but they should be long enough to accommodate longer legs and provide proper foot placement during lifts.
- Weight Benches with Extended Length: Some benches are specifically designed with a longer surface area, catering to taller individuals. These benches allow users to lie flat without their legs hanging off the edge, providing a more comfortable and safer lifting experience.
- Multi-Functional Benches: These benches offer a variety of configurations for different exercises, which can be beneficial for taller users. They typically include features like leg extension attachments and decline settings, allowing for a more versatile workout while accommodating longer body lengths.
- Powerlifting Benches: Designed for serious lifters, these benches often have a wider and longer platform. They provide exceptional stability and support for heavier lifts, making them a suitable choice for taller users who need a robust option for their rigorous training sessions.

Why Are Flat Weight Benches Suitable for Taller Individuals?
Flat weight benches are suitable for taller individuals primarily because they provide adequate length and support for their body size, ensuring comfort and proper alignment during exercises.
According to a study published by the National Strength and Conditioning Association, the effectiveness of resistance training is significantly influenced by the equipment used, particularly in relation to user dimensions. Taller individuals often require benches that accommodate their longer limb lengths to optimize biomechanics and reduce the risk of injury while lifting weights.
The underlying mechanism involves the relationship between body proportions and exercise effectiveness. A flat weight bench allows for a stable surface that supports longer arms and legs, which is essential during exercises like bench presses or dumbbell flies. If a bench is too short, it can lead to improper form, causing strain on joints and muscles that can lead to injury. Additionally, benches designed for taller individuals often have a higher weight capacity and sturdier construction, further enhancing safety and performance during workouts.
